Just Brakes Peoria - Hours & Locations
Just Brakes - Chandler
1266 Chandler Blvd, Chandler AZ 85224 Phone Number:(480) 899-3239Hours may fluctuate
Distance:28.63 miles
Just Brakes - Mesa
3007 East Main St., Mesa AZ 85213 Phone Number:(480) 733-2633Hours may fluctuate
Distance:29.47 miles
Just Brakes - Gilbert
3347 E. Baseline Rd, Gilbert AZ 85234 Phone Number:(480) 539-5566Hours may fluctuate
Distance:30.94 miles